The Rise of Custom Uniforms in Australia
The uniform industry in Australia has witnessed a significant transformation over the last few years. Businesses are no longer satisfied with generic, off-the-shelf uniform options. Instead, they seek uniforms that reflect their brand identity, cater to their employees’ comfort, and meet the demands of their operational environments. This shift has created an increased demand for private label uniform suppliers who can deliver highly customized garments.
The Benefits of Private Label Uniform Suppliers
1. Brand Identity
Private label uniform suppliers allow businesses to create uniforms that resonate with their brand. Custom designs, colors, and logos ensure that each piece of clothing is aligned with the company’s identity. This not only enhances brand visibility but also fosters a sense of belonging among employees.
2. Functional Design
Different industries have varying requirements for their uniforms. For instance, healthcare workers need materials that are durable and easy to clean, while construction workers require garments that are robust and safe. Custom uniform suppliers can design functional clothing that meets these specific needs, ensuring comfort and practicality for employees.
3. Quality Assurance
One of the main advantages of working with private label suppliers is the level of quality control they offer. Businesses can work closely with suppliers to ensure that the materials and construction standards are up to the mark. This ensures longevity and durability in the uniforms, which can be a significant cost-saving factor in the long run.
4. Scalability
As businesses grow, their uniform needs may change. Private label suppliers offer scalability, allowing companies to adjust their orders based on the number of employees or changing branding requirements. This flexibility is crucial for businesses aiming for continuous growth and adaptation.
5. Sustainability
With an increasing emphasis on environmentally-friendly practices, many private label uniform suppliers are incorporating sustainable materials into their offerings. Companies looking to enhance their corporate social responsibility can collaborate with suppliers who provide eco-friendly uniforms, contributing positively to the environment.

How to Choose the Right Supplier
When opting for a private label uniform supplier, several factors should be considered:
1. Experience and Reputation
Choose suppliers that have a proven track record within the industry. Look for customer testimonials and case studies that showcase their past work and success.
2. Range of Services
Look for suppliers that offer comprehensive services including design, manufacturing, and logistical support. A one-stop-shop approach can save time and hassle.
3. Flexibility and Customization Options
Ensure that the supplier can provide the level of customization your business requires, from style and material to branding options.
4. Certifications and Compliance
Verify the ethical and quality certifications of the supplier. This not only assures product quality but also supports ethical business practices.
